Local Access Cable Television Commission
Five members/one year term. Oversees local access channels assigned to Saline by its Cable TV Franchise Ordinance and assists in providing local access television programming to the community.

Ethics Committee
Three members and two alternates will serve on an as needed basis to review complaints of ethics violations by elected officials, and make recommendations to the Council body on the validity of such claims. The Committee is supported by the City Clerk and City Manager in the processing of complaint materials. The absence of any complaints, the body meets once annually for basic training.
